@marinewife4: Just butting in here. If you have good lighting, a well trained MUA, and a good photog, you should be fine regardless of the foundation SPF level. Especially if your MUA properly sets the foundation with a translucent powder that doesn’t have lots of MICA or Silica in it. I love Lancome foundations and wear Teint Idole (the 24 hour wear) foundation as my every day foundation in the summer because it so light weight. I love the stuff!
Avoid glittery and shimmery products (for eye shaddow and blushes specifically) as they will reflect light and can look harsh in certain lighting. Also remember that your photographer will retouch your photos anyway, so if there is any flashback or glare, he/she will tone it down before you ever even see the proofs.
